1 / 11

ReactJS Training In Hyderabad - React JS Training in Ameerpet

ReactJS Training In Hyderabad - VisualPath offers the Best React Js Online Training conducted by real-time experts. Our ReactJS Training is available in Hyderabad and is provided to individuals globally in the USA, UK, Canada, Dubai, and Australia. Contact us at 91-9989971070.<br>Blog:https://cypressonlinetraining-123.blogspot.com/<br>whatsApp: https://www.whatsapp.com/catalog/919989971070<br>Visit:https://visualpath.in/ReactJs-Training-in-Hyderabad.html<br><br>

Madhavi12
Download Presentation

ReactJS Training In Hyderabad - React JS Training in Ameerpet

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Exploring the Fundamental Concepts of React JS +91-9989971070 www.visualpath.in

  2. In the ever-evolving landscape of web development, React JS has emerged as a powerful and widely adopted JavaScript library for building user interfaces. Developed and maintained by Facebook, React JS introduces a component-based architecture that revolutionizes the way developers design and manage UI elements. Let's delve into the fundamental concepts that form the backbone of React JS. www.visualpath.in

  3. 1. Component-Based Architecture: At the heart of React JS lies the concept of components. A React application is built by composing these reusable and self-contained building blocks, each encapsulating its logic and rendering. Components can be as simple as a button or as complex as an entire page. This modular approach facilitates code reusability, maintainability, and scalability. www.visualpath.in

  4. 2. JSX (JavaScript XML): React uses a syntax extension called JSX, which allows developers to write HTML-like code within JavaScript files. JSX makes it easier to express the structure of UI components, making the code more readable and maintainable. Under the hood, JSX gets transpiled into JavaScript, ensuring compatibility with browsers. www.visualpath.in

  5. 3. Virtual DOM (Document Object Model): React'sVirtual DOM is a crucial performance optimization. Instead of directly manipulating the actual DOM, React creates a lightweight in-memory representation of the DOM. When there's a change in the state of a component, React compares the virtual DOM with the actual DOM and updates only the necessary parts. This minimizes the number of DOM manipulations, resulting in faster and more efficient rendering. www.visualpath.in

  6. 4. State and Props: State and props are two essential concepts for managing data in React components. State represents the internal data of a component, and when it changes, React triggers a re-render. Props, short for properties, are used to pass data from a parent component to a child component. By managing state and props effectively, React enables dynamic and interactive user interfaces www.visualpath.in

  7. 5. Lifecycle Methods: React components go through a lifecycle, from creation to destruction. Developers can tap into this lifecycle by utilizing lifecycle methods. These methods allow for executing code at specific points in a component's existence, such as when it is first mounted or when it is about to be unmounted. Leveraging lifecycle methods enhances control over the behavior of components. www.visualpath.in

  8. 6. React Hooks: Introduced in React 16.8, hooks are functions that enable developers to use state and other React features in functional components. Hooks like useState and useEffect eliminate the need for class components, making functional components more powerful and concise. This functional approach aligns with modern JavaScript practices and simplifies the development process. www.visualpath.in

  9. In conclusion, understanding these fundamental concepts of React JS lays a solid foundation for building dynamic and efficient user interfaces. By embracing a component-based architecture, JSX syntax, Virtual DOM, state and props management, lifecycle methods, and hooks, developers can harness the full potential of React to create responsive and scalable web applications. As React continues to evolve, mastering these concepts ensures developers stay at the forefront of web development trends.A www.visualpath.in

  10. CONTACT For More Information About Address:- Flat no: 205, 2nd Floor NilagiriBlock, Aditya Enclave, Ameerpet, Hyderabad-16 PhNo : +91-9989971070 Visit : www.visualpath.in E-Mail : online@visualpath.in

  11. THANK YOU Visit: www.visualpath.in

More Related